Output 6444ae3233196d9266ef732abd5116a95256fde258b6b81ebf1b9794a3a392fe:1

value
2053539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b2c61f93d7abc39c82ea1d0b8a87cd71ac8874 OP_EQUAL
address
3KXmrP1o6nVWgDU5LGVNRr76NpD5XZzrpV
transaction
6444ae3233196d9266ef732abd5116a95256fde258b6b81ebf1b9794a3a392fe
spent
true